Abstract
The monograph of the American researcher’s J.M. Ways is dedicated to the problem of the Mexican immigration on the Dixie during the centenary period from 1910 to 2010 years. The author showed the different types of the settlement behavior and priorities of Mexicanos (bracero) in the conditions of other political and language sphere on five regions. She pointed to the complexity of the permission of Latinos’ problem in the internal American policy because they have already became the integral part of the American society.
